Fannie Mae MSR Financing The Company, through two subsidiaries, PMT ISSUER TRUST-FMSR and PMT CO-ISSUER TRUST-FMSR (together, the "Issuer Trusts"), finances MSRs owned by PMC and the related excess servicing spread ("ESS") owned by PennyMac Holdings, LLC (“PMH”), another subsidiary of PMT, through a combination of repurchase agreements and term financing. The repurchase agreement financings for Fannie Mae MSRs and ESS are effected through the issuance of variable funding notes (a Series 2017-VF1 Note, a Series 2024-VF1 Note, and a Series 2024-VF2 Note, together the "FMSR VFNs") by the Issuer Trusts to PMC and PMH in exchange for participation certificates for MSRs and ESS. The FMSR VFNs are then sold by PMC and PMH to qualified institutional buyers under agreements to repurchase. The amounts outstanding under the FMSR VFNs are included in Assets sold under agreements to repurchase in the Company’s consolidated balance sheets. The FMSR VFNs have a combined committed borrowing capacity of $1.1 billion under two-year repurchase agreement facilities. The term financing for Fannie Mae MSRs is effected through the issuance of term notes (the “FT-1 Term Notes”) by the Issuer Trusts to qualified institutional buyers under Rule 144A of the Securities Act and a series of syndicated term loans with various lenders (the “FTL-1 Term Loans"). The FT-1 Term Notes, FTL-1 Term Loans and the FMSR VFNs are secured by participation certificates relating to Fannie Mae MSRs and ESS and rank pari passu with each other. Freddie Mac MSR and Servicing Advance Receivables Financing The Company, through PMC and PMH, finances certain MSRs (including any related ESS) relating to loans pooled into Freddie Mac securities through various credit agreements. The total loan amount available under the agreements is approximately $2.0 billion, bearing interest at an annual rate equal to SOFR plus a spread as defined in each agreement. The agreements have maturities on various dates through . The total loan amount available under the agreements may be reduced by other debt outstanding with the counterparties. Advances under the credit agreements are secured by MSRs relating to loans serviced for Freddie Mac guaranteed securities. The Company, through its indirect, wholly owned subsidiaries, PMT ISSUER TRUST - FHLMC SAF, PMT SAF Funding, LLC, and PMC, entered into a structured finance transaction that PMC may use to finance Freddie Mac servicing advance receivables (the “Series 2023-VF1”). The maturity date of the related Series 2023-VF1, Class A-VF1 Variable Funding Note is March 6, 2026 and has a maximum principal amount of $175 million. The exchangeable senior notes are exchangeable for: (1) cash for the principal amount of the notes to be exchanged; and (2) cash, Common Shares or a combination of cash and Common Shares, at the Company’s election, for the remainder, if any, of the exchange obligation in excess of the principal amount of the notes being exchanged, at any time until the close of business on the second scheduled trading day immediately preceding the maturity date. Interest on the senior notes is payable quarterly. PMT may redeem for cash all or any portion of the senior notes, at its option, at a redemption price equal to 100% of the principal amount of the notes to be redeemed, plus accrued and unpaid interest to, but excluding, the applicable redemption date. The senior notes are fully and unconditionally guaranteed on a senior unsecured basis by PMC, including the due and punctual payment of principal and interest, whether at stated maturity, upon acceleration, call for redemption or otherwise. The asset-backed financings are non-recourse liabilities and are secured solely by the assets of consolidated VIEs and not by any other assets of the Company. The assets of the VIEs are the only source of funds for repayment of the asset-backed financings.
